The acute (short-term) effects of methylene chloride inhalation in humans consist mainly of nervous system effects … WebMethyl chloride-methylene chloride is a colorless gas with a faint sweet odor. It is shipped as a liquefied gas under its vapor pressure. Contact with the liquid can cause frostbite. It is easily ignited. The vapors are heavier than air. It can asphyxiate by the displacement of air.
